Bad Bunny Headlines Super Bowl Halftime With Mixed Reception

At Sunday’s Super Bowl, Puerto Rican star Bad Bunny headlined an elaborate, Spanish-language halftime show featuring Lady Gaga and Ricky Martin, while Jon Bon Jovi introduced the Patriots and Charlie Puth sang the national anthem. The author praises the show's cinematic staging but criticizes its musical clarity and polarizing choice, arguing the NFL prioritized global expansion into Spanish-speaking markets over broad domestic appeal.
